Introduce dw2_linkage_name and dw2_linkage_name_attr.
The DWARF reader is littered with the following idiom to read a linkage name
from the debug info:
mangled = dwarf2_string_attr (die, DW_AT_linkage_name, cu);
if (mangled == NULL)
mangled = dwarf2_string_attr (die, DW_AT_MIPS_linkage_name, cu);
This patch introduces functions to simplify this to:
mangled = dw2_linkage_name (die, cu);
or
attr = dw2_linkage_name_attr (die, cu);
gdb/ChangeLog:
* dwarf2read.c (dw2_linkage_name_attr): New function.
(dw2_linkage_name): New function.
(dwarf2_compute_name, dwarf2_physname, read_call_site_scope)
(guess_full_die_structure_name, dwarf2_name): Use dw2_linkage_name.
(anonymous_struct_prefix, dwarf2_name): Use dw2_linkage_name_attr.
